What does it mean when the check engine light comes on in a 2026 Genesis G70?
It signals that the vehicle’s onboard diagnostics detected an emissions, fuel, or engine system fault. The light can indicate anything from a loose gas cap to a serious engine misfire. What is the most common reason for check engine light on a 2026 Genesis G70?
Common causes include oxygen sensor faults, catalytic converter efficiency issues, fuel trim or injector problems, and misfires. A loose or damaged gas cap can also trigger the light. Left unaddressed, these issues can reduce fuel economy, increase emissions, and cause expensive engine damage—repairing them promptly protects performance and resale value. 2026 Genesis G70 Check Engine Light Codes
Common check engine codes for the 2026 Genesis G70 include P030x (misfire), P0420 (catalyst efficiency), P0171/P0174 (lean condition), and oxygen sensor codes. Each has distinct risks and cost implications: misfires can damage catalytic converters and lead to costly repairs if ignored; a P0420 left unrepaired accelerates emissions system wear and can trigger failed inspections; lean conditions reduce performance and fuel economy and may cause long-term engine stress. Check Engine Light Flashing
A flashing check engine light on a 2026 Genesis G70 indicates an active misfire or condition that can cause immediate engine damage. This is a drive-now-or-stop situation: continuing to drive risks harming the catalytic converter and other engine components.
